Key Responsibilities:
Produce detailed fabrication drawings, general arrangement drawings, and erection plans using 3D modelling software (e.g., Tekla Structures or similar).
Interpret engineering and architectural drawings to create accurate steelwork details.
Liaise with internal teams including design, fabrication, and project management to ensure detailing output aligns with company standards and project requirements.
Support the checking and coordination of drawing packages and revisions.
Learn and adapt to internal processes, standards, and workflows with close mentoring from senior team members.
Assist with document control, drawing registers, and project-related administrative tasks as needed.
